How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Timber Ridge?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Timber Ridge Studio Apartments | $861 | $599 | $1,633 |
| Timber Ridge 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,099 | $599 | $1,780 |
| Timber Ridge 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,386 | $850 | $2,674 |
| Timber Ridge 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,581 | $1,115 | $2,514 |
